What type of text structure would you use if you wanted to write an essay that explains the steps a scientist uses to track a po

lar bear? a. expository c. descriptive b. narrative d. persuasive Please select the best answer from the choices provided A B C D

Answer:  the answer is expository

Explanation:  The key word is explain. Exspository means to explain or describe something, so the answer would be A if you wanted to explain the steps a scientist uses to track a polar bear.

The primary purpose of a conclusion in an informative essay is to
vodka [1.7K]

Answer:

The primary purpose of a conclusion in an informative essay is to

B. refer back to the thesis.

Explanation:

In essay writing, the conclusion is the final paragraph.<u> Its purpose is to refer back to the thesis, that is, to restate what was initially claimed by the author. A conclusion should never present new information, examples, or evidence, otherwise it would not be a conclusion at all, but merely an extension of the essay's body. It should wrap up by once again reaffirming the main idea or topic in a shorter manner, with fewer words. Therefore, the best option for this question is B. refer back to the thesis.</u>
